Rolpa bus mishap claims four lives, 14 injured



ROLPA: A devastating bus accident in Rolpa’s Bagmara en route to Dang’s Ghorahi has resulted in the untimely demise of four individuals, with an additional 14 passengers left wounded.

The accident took place at Triveni-7, Gairigaon, Rolpa.

According to local reports, the ill-fated Na 5 kha 2612 bus plummeted a staggering 50 meters off the road during the mishap.

The incident occurred today around 1 pm, as the bus was careening at a notably high velocity before spiraling out of control.

Regrettably, among those affected is a missing child whose whereabouts are currently under extensive search operations conducted by local residents.

The identities of the deceased victims are yet to be ascertained.

District Superintendent of Police (DSP) Shyam Saru Magar informed that upon receiving immediate notification of the tragic event, a dedicated police unit led by a police inspector was promptly dispatched from the district headquarters. The Chief District Officer and police authorities were duly apprised of the calamity by 1:30 pm.

Injured survivors, including the bus driver, have been expeditiously transferred to the District Hospital for necessary medical attention, as confirmed by law enforcement officials.
